Sinners Condemned by Somme Sketcher
*PART ONE OF A DUET* \n\nNo good ever comes from a red-head in a stolen dress with her worldly possessions at her feet. \n\nI should have known she was trouble when smoke and sin followed her into my bar and she challenged me to a game. \n\nShe may have won my watch, but she started a war. \n\nAs she slipped my Breitling off my wrist and onto her own, she gleefully announced she was the luckiest girl in the world. \n\nYeah, lucky to everyone but me. \n\nBecause the moment her muddy boots stomped down the stairs and up my spine, my empire started to crumble. \n\nMy cashmere charm is wrinkling. \n\nMy gentlemanly facade is cracking. \n\nMy enemies are closing in. \n\nMaybe the gypsy was right: \n\nThe Queen of Hearts will drag me down to hell. \n\nAt least it?s wonderfully warm among the flames. \n\nDARK MAFIA ROMANCE ? ENEMIES TO LOVERS ? AGE GAP ? SLOW BURN \n\n*** \n\nSOMME?S NOTES: \n\nSinners Condemned is part one of a duet, and because of this, it ends on a cliffhanger. Rafe & Penny?s story continues in Sinners Consumed, which will be out September 7. \n\nFor a better reading experience, please read Sinners Anonymous before reading Sinners Condemned. \n\nYou should know that I write dark romance, and my stories?including this one?aren?t for the faint of heart. They contain several triggers, so aren?t suitable for everyone.
